Role Summary

Lead signal- and power-integrity engineering for Starlink satellite payload hardware across the full product lifecycle, from silicon/package evaluation and stackup selection through PCB layout, qualification, and field troubleshooting.

This role is highly cross-functional and requires defining SI/PI processes, simulations, test methodologies, and lab capabilities used across the Starlink payload organization.

Experience Level

Senior engineer. Typical background: 5+ years industry experience designing circuits, electronic products, or hardware, with domain experience in high-speed digital channels and power integrity.

Responsibilities

Primary responsibilities include analysis, specification, verification, and support of SI/PI for satellite payload hardware.

  • Specify, design, simulate, verify, qualify and troubleshoot SI and PI for advanced satellite hardware (high-speed SERDES, optoelectronics, memory interfaces, PDNs).
  • Evaluate IP, package, and PCB stackups; derive top-level PCB material and channel specifications.
  • Design and optimize transitions and channel structures from die-to-die and across package/PCB boundaries.
  • Drive component selection and define PDN architecture for ASICs, FPGAs, and processors.
  • Collaborate with RF, antenna, ASIC, packaging, mechanical, thermal, software, supply chain, and production teams to architect and validate new products.
  • Lead root-cause analysis and fixes for issues found in PCB fabrication, PCBA test, or satellite integration.
  • Establish best practices, simulation workflows, signoff criteria, test methodologies, and lab/equipment requirements for SI/PI work.
